Snapchat Video Downloading Methods
Method 1: Save Your Own Snaps
The most basic of the Snapchat downloading methods involves saving your own snaps and stories. Snapchat provides an easy feature for this right within the app. Users can save snaps by tapping the save icon before sending out the snap or story. Saved snaps will appear in your Memories, a personal collection where you can view, edit, and organise your saved content. To save a story after posting, simply open your story, tap the three dots for more options, and tap ‘Save.’

Method 3: Screen Recording Feature on Smartphones
Many smartphone users are unaware that their devices come with a built-in screen recording feature, which serves as an easy Snapchat downloading method for those looking to save videos they’ve viewed. On an iOS device, you can enable the screen recording feature from the Control Center and on an Android device, the feature can typically be found in the Quick Settings. Once enabled, you can record Snap videos that you’re viewing. However, keep in mind that Snapchat will notify the sender that the video is being recorded.
Method 4: Use Another Device to Record
If you want to avoid sending a notification entirely when saving a Snapchat video, one of the simplest Snapchat downloading methods is to use another camera or device to record the snap as it plays on your screen. While this might not result in the highest quality replica of the video, it is a way to capture the content without using screen recording or third-party software.
Method 5: File Manager on Android Devices
Another method that falls into a gray area involves using a file manager on Android devices. Some users have discovered that Snapchat stores videos in a temporary folder on the device. By using a file manager app before opening the snap, it’s possible to locate and save the video. However, this is not an officially supported Snapchat downloading method, and it risks violating the terms of service and the privacy of those involved.

Method 7: Saving Snapchat Memories
Finally, Snapchat’s ‘Memories’ feature includes an option to back up your snaps. Ensure your memories are set to save within the app’s settings, and they will be stored in your Snapchat account. You can access your Memories any time and export them to your camera roll or a cloud service, offering a Snapchat downloading method for snaps you’ve created and posted that doesn’t involve third parties.
